Photo exhibit depicts Frank Lloyd Wright-designed buildings at Florida Southern College

Sep
30
6:00 pm

This exhibit of photographs of  buildings at Florida Southern College, taken by photographer Robin Hill, represents the largest integrated collection of Wright structures in the world, built between 1938 and 1959. Sponsored by the World Monuments Fund, the photographs were included in the Guggenheim Museum’s recent show Frank Lloyd Wright: From Within Outward.  The series will also be included in the upcoming Guggenheim Museum Bilbao exhibit from October 23 through February 14.

Hill will be a guest lecturer next week on Wednesday, September 30 at 6 p.m. in the Jorge M. Perez Architecture Center, Glasgow Hall, followed by a tour of the exhibit.

The exhibit will be open in the Irvin Korach Gallery in the Jorge M. Perez Architecture Center through Sunday, October 11.  The exhibition is free and open to the public and is available for viewing Monday through Friday from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m.
